According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Salking village is 376980. Salking village is located in Gudri subdivision of Pashchimi Singhbhum district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 85km away from sub-district headquarter Chakradharpur (podahat) (tehsildar office) and 110km away from district headquarter Chaibasa. As per 2009 stats, Bandu is the gram panchayat of Salking village.
The total geographical area of village is 144.51 hectares. Salking has a total population of 559 peoples, out of which male population is 289 while female population is 270. Literacy rate of salking village is 32.20% out of which 38.75% males and 25.19% females are literate. There are about 118 houses in salking village. Pincode of salking village locality is 833105.
When it comes to administration, Salking village is administrated by a sarpanch who is elected representative of the village by the local elections. As per 2019 stats, Salking village comes under Manoharpur Vidhan Sabha constituency & Singhbhum Lok Sabha constituency. Gudri is nearest town to salking village for all major economic activities.
